At The Red Piano, we're a swanky spot where warm vibes meet great tunes. Our red-brick exposed venue is where live music and expertly crafted cocktails come together. We've built a reputation on serving up top-notch drinks alongside delicious bar fare that's sure to hit the spot. Reviewers rave about our cozy atmosphere, from the intimate setting to the exceptional service that always puts a smile on your face. From our signature small plates to our extensive selection of craft beers and wines, we're all about creating an unforgettable experience for you.

What Customers Say About The Red Piano

The Red Piano is a lively bar known for its live piano entertainment and fun atmosphere. Customers rave about the talented musicians, especially Jason and Alex Ivy, and the attentive bartenders like Natalie and Gigi. It's a popular spot for celebrations and late-night fun.

Best For

Groups Celebrations Late Night Tourists Locals

Tip: Go on Wednesday or Thursday for a more mellow experience, or visit on the weekend for a lively atmosphere. Be prepared for a busy bar, especially on Saturday nights.
